viuavm-commits
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Viuavm-commits] [SCM] Viua VM branch devel updated. v0.8.4-461-g4f30377


From: git
Subject: [Viuavm-commits] [SCM] Viua VM branch devel updated. v0.8.4-461-g4f30377
Date: Fri, 28 Oct 2016 02:40:20 +0200 (CEST)

This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"Viua VM".

The branch, devel has been updated
       via  4f303776b51f0bd5409296526a702a93247a5bfa (commit)
      from  ffd466a5b012fb46cda1a36b68eccdb3e8908a00 (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
commit 4f303776b51f0bd5409296526a702a93247a5bfa
Author: Marek Marecki <address@hidden>
Date:   Fri Oct 28 02:22:51 2016 +0200

    Rename "enclose" instructions as "capture"

-----------------------------------------------------------------------

Summary of changes:
 Changelog.markdown                                 |  1 +
 include/viua/bytecode/maps.h                       | 12 +++++-----
 include/viua/bytecode/opcodes.h                    |  6 ++---
 .../exceptions/closure_from_nonlocal_registers.asm |  4 ++--
 sample/asm/functions/closures/adder.asm            |  4 ++--
 ...=> capturecopy_creates_independent_objects.asm} |  6 ++---
 ...ope.asm => captured_variable_left_in_scope.asm} |  6 ++---
 .../change_enclosed_variable_from_closure.asm      |  6 ++---
 sample/asm/functions/closures/nested_closures.asm  | 22 ++++++++---------
 sample/asm/functions/closures/shared_variables.asm |  4 ++--
 sample/asm/functions/closures/simple.asm           |  2 +-
 .../functions/closures/simple_enclose_by_copy.asm  |  4 ++--
 .../functions/closures/simple_enclose_by_move.asm  |  4 ++--
 .../asm/functions/higher_order/filter_closure.asm  |  2 +-
 .../higher_order/filter_closure_vector_by_move.asm |  2 +-
 sample/asm/functions/return_by_reference.asm       |  4 ++--
 .../capture_empty_register_by_copy.asm}            |  2 +-
 .../capture_empty_register_by_move.asm}            |  2 +-
 .../capture_empty_register_by_reference.asm}       |  2 +-
 .../enclose_empty_register_by_copy.asm             | 25 -------------------
 .../enclose_empty_register_by_move.asm             | 25 -------------------
 .../enclose_empty_register_by_reference.asm        | 25 -------------------
 src/cg/assembler/static_analysis.cpp               |  2 +-
 src/cg/bytecode/instructions.cpp                   |  8 +++----
 src/cg/disassembler/disassembler.cpp               |  6 ++---
 src/cg/lex.cpp                                     |  2 +-
 src/front/asm/generate.cpp                         | 12 +++++-----
 src/process/dispatch.cpp                           |  6 ++---
 src/process/instr/closure.cpp                      | 24 +++++++++----------
 tests/tests.py                                     | 28 +++++++++++-----------
 30 files changed, 92 insertions(+), 166 deletions(-)
 rename 
sample/asm/functions/closures/{enclosecopy_creates_independent_objects.asm => 
capturecopy_creates_independent_objects.asm} (89%)
 rename sample/asm/functions/closures/{enclosed_variable_left_in_scope.asm => 
captured_variable_left_in_scope.asm} (88%)
 copy sample/asm/{concurrency/receive_timeout_zero_milliseconds.asm => 
static_analysis_errors/capture_empty_register_by_copy.asm} (97%)
 copy sample/asm/{concurrency/receive_timeout_zero_milliseconds.asm => 
static_analysis_errors/capture_empty_register_by_move.asm} (97%)
 copy sample/asm/{errors/branch_without_operands.asm => 
static_analysis_errors/capture_empty_register_by_reference.asm} (97%)
 delete mode 100644 
sample/asm/static_analysis_errors/enclose_empty_register_by_copy.asm
 delete mode 100644 
sample/asm/static_analysis_errors/enclose_empty_register_by_move.asm
 delete mode 100644 
sample/asm/static_analysis_errors/enclose_empty_register_by_reference.asm


hooks/post-receive
-- 
Viua VM



reply via email to

[Prev in Thread] Current Thread [Next in Thread]